Simple Example <br /> 3 acre tract zoned Light Industrial (LI) <br /> located in a CITAN <br /> Current <br /> FAR max = 0.20 = 26,136 s.f. <br /> Height, max = 45 ft. <br /> Open Space, min. = 0.80 = 104,544 s.f. (2.4 acres) <br /> Pedestrian/Landscape, min = 0.20 = 26,135 s.f. <br /> Proposed <br /> FAR max = 0.60 = 78,408 s.f. <br /> Height, max = 45 ft. <br /> Open Space, min. = 0.45 = 58,806 s.f. (1.35 acres) <br /> Pedestrian/Landscape, min = 0.05 = 6,534 s.f. <br /> Recommendation <br /> 1.
